The ideal candidate will be responsible for evaluating and treating patients to help them achieve their maximum potential in daily living and working activities. This role will involve working in various settings, including clinics, skilled nursing facilities, acute care, geriatrics, schools, early intervention programs, and outpatient services. Duties Conduct comprehensive assessments of patients' physical, emotional, and social needs. Develop individualized treatment plans based on patient evaluations. Implement therapeutic interventions to improve patients' functional abilities.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to ensure holistic patient care. Provide education and support to patients and their families regarding treatment plans and progress. Document patient progress and modify treatment plans as necessary. Participate in case management activities to coordinate care effectively. Assist patients in developing skills for daily living and working environments. Experience A degree in Occupational Therapy from an accredited program is required. State licensure or certification as an Occupational Therapist is mandatory. Experience in various settings such as clinics, skilled nursing facilities, acute care, geriatrics, schools, early intervention programs, or outpatient services is preferred.
